Responsibilities

Support the Navy SSP customer in a fast paced new Acquisition development program for the Nuclear Sea-Launched Cruise Missile (SLCM-N) program.  The successful candidate will support the integration of a cruise missile air vehicle with the Submarine Launcher, System Fire Control, and Nuclear Warhead.  This position will lead the coordination and integration efforts for Air Vehicle integration across multiple Government and Contractor organizations.  This position will be responsible for coordinating between the system level design activities within Navy SSP, the Air Vehicle design activities occurring with NAVAIR, and ship integration activities primarily executed by TEAMSUB.  This position will lead multiple, cross-team working groups to ensure design engineering teams within each of the subsystem design organizations are working to integrate designs, study and trade-off cross sub-system design implications, and coordinate interfaces including the mechanical, electrical, shock, hydrodynamic, temperature and pressure environments the system will traverse. The coordination activities will include technical planning, scheduling, and execution of critical design, integration, testing, and verification activities throughout the development and integration processes.  The position will provide leadership and management support for multidisciplinary study teams and perform study planning, coordination of modeling and simulation tasks, evaluation of study results, evaluation of contractor detailed designs, data extraction and analysis, and briefing to senior program leadership.  Provide support for the development of system requirements, specifications, and architecture.
